Hello all,
Has anyone noticed how when word wrap is enabled, text still flows off the screen. To see this text, you must use a mouse drag action because word wrap mode disables the horizontal scroll bar. I think this is a bug!
Anyhow, got tired of word wrap because of that problem and that it also makes it more difficult to read the HTML.
With word wrap disabled, I thought, it would be great if the font size could be changed (just like any of my other tools). A smaller font would allow me to view more of my code.
Is this possible?

Re: Reduce the Internal Text editor font size. Possible?
I'm pretty sure that the editor font size is the Windows default. Try changing that:
1) In the Control Panel, search for "Colors and Metrics". (There doesn't seem to be a link for it any more.)
2) Open, "Change Window Colors and Metrics"
3) Have a blast.
